The Importance of Proper Tire Pressure
The pressure inside your tires directly influences their shape and how they interact with the road surface. When tires are properly inflated, they maintain a consistent contact patch with the road, providing optimal grip, handling, and stability. This is essential for safe cornering, braking, and accelerating. Underinflated tires, on the other hand, have a larger contact patch, leading to increased rolling resistance and decreased fuel efficiency. Overinflated tires, conversely, have a smaller contact patch, resulting in a harsher ride and reduced traction, particularly in wet or slippery conditions.
Safety Implications
Maintaining the correct tire pressure is paramount for safety. Underinflated tires are more prone to blowouts, especially at high speeds. They also increase your braking distance, making it harder to stop safely in an emergency. Overinflated tires, while less likely to blowout, offer reduced traction and can make your vehicle more susceptible to skidding or losing control, particularly during cornering or sudden maneuvers.
Fuel Efficiency
Properly inflated tires reduce rolling resistance, which is the force that opposes the motion of a rolling object. By minimizing rolling resistance, your engine doesn’t have to work as hard to propel your vehicle, leading to improved fuel economy. Underinflated tires can significantly reduce your fuel efficiency, costing you money at the pump.
Tire Wear and Tear
Incorrect tire pressure can lead to uneven wear patterns, reducing the lifespan of your tires. Underinflation causes the center of the tire to wear more quickly, while overinflation causes the edges to wear down prematurely. Maintaining the recommended tire pressure ensures even wear and extends the life of your tires.
Finding the Right Tire Pressure
The recommended tire pressure for your vehicle is specific to your car model and can vary depending on factors such as load capacity and driving conditions. The best place to find this information is in your vehicle’s owner’s manual or on a sticker located on the driver’s side doorjamb. This sticker will list the recommended tire pressure for both front and rear tires, typically in pounds per square inch (PSI).
Understanding PSI

Checking Tire Pressure
It’s important to check your tire pressure regularly, ideally when the tires are cold. This means the vehicle has not been driven for at least three hours. Here’s how to check your tire pressure:
- Remove the valve stem cap from the tire.
- Press the tire pressure gauge firmly onto the valve stem.
- Read the pressure displayed on the gauge.
- Replace the valve stem cap.
Adjusting Tire Pressure
If your tire pressure is too low, you can add air using an air compressor. Most gas stations offer air compressors for a small fee. If your tire pressure is too high, you can release some air by pressing the small pin located in the center of the valve stem with a tire pressure gauge or a special tool called a tire pressure valve core remover.
Using an Air Compressor
Connect the air hose from the compressor to the valve stem of the tire. Make sure the compressor is set to the desired PSI. Slowly add air to the tire, checking the pressure frequently with the gauge. Once the desired pressure is reached, disconnect the air hose.

Factors Affecting Tire Pressure
Several factors can affect your tire pressure, including:
Temperature
Tire pressure increases as temperature rises and decreases as temperature falls. This is because the air inside the tire expands when heated and contracts when cooled. It’s important to check your tire pressure when the tires are cold, as the pressure will be higher when the tires are hot. (See Also: How Much Air In A Car Tire? The Ultimate Guide)
Altitude
Air pressure decreases as altitude increases. This means that your tire pressure will also decrease at higher altitudes. You may need to adjust your tire pressure accordingly when driving in mountainous areas.
